2005 Land Rover LR3 problems & reliability
96 owner complaints filed with NHTSA for the 2005 Land Rover LR3, alongside 4 safety recall campaigns. Last verified Aug 7, 2026. Complaints are unverified reports submitted by owners to the federal Office of Defects Investigation.
Each complaint is counted once (by NHTSA case number), even when it names several vehicles.
Federal crash records (FARS 2020–2023): 2005 Land Rover LR3 vehicles were involved in 6 fatal crashes with 4 occupant deaths. Involvement counts are not adjusted for how many are on the road and do not imply fault or a vehicle defect.
Most reported problems
| Component | Complaints | Share |
|---|---|---|
| Suspension | 20 | 21% |
| Electrical System | 19 | 20% |
| Power Train | 16 | 17% |
| Fuel System, Gasoline | 15 | 16% |
| Tires | 15 | 16% |
| Structure | 10 | 10% |
| Air Bags | 7 | 7% |
| Visibility | 6 | 6% |
| Engine and Engine Cooling | 5 | 5% |
| Steering | 5 | 5% |
Component groups as classified by NHTSA. A complaint can name more than one component, so shares may sum to more than 100%.

Mileage when problems occurred
Half of the failures with a reported odometer reading occurred by 42,000 miles (middle 50% between 15,265 and 77,234 miles), based on 70 complaints that included mileage.

TSBs are repair guidance manufacturers send to dealers — they are not recalls and repairs are not automatically free. Full documents are available on NHTSA’s site.
Safety recalls
The 2005 Land Rover LR3 has 4 NHTSA recall campaigns — recall repairs are free at franchised dealers regardless of the vehicle’s age.
